### What Exactly is an Electric Food Slicer?

At its core, an electric food slicer is a motorized appliance designed to slice food items with precision and consistency. Unlike manual slicers, which rely on human power and skill, electric slicers use a rotating blade powered by an electric motor. This allows for effortless slicing, even with tougher items like frozen meats or hard cheeses.

The evolution of food slicers has been remarkable. Originally designed for commercial use in butcher shops and delis, these machines have been adapted for home use, becoming more compact, affordable, and user-friendly. The underlying principle remains the same: to provide consistent, uniform slices with minimal effort.

### Core Concepts and Advanced Principles

The key to understanding electric food slicers lies in understanding their components and how they work together. The main elements include:

* **The Blade:** Typically made of stainless steel, the blade is the heart of the slicer. Blade size and type (smooth or serrated) are crucial factors in determining the slicer’s versatility.
* **The Motor:** The motor powers the blade and determines the slicer’s cutting power. Higher wattage motors are generally more powerful and can handle tougher foods.
* **The Carriage:** The carriage holds the food item and moves it across the blade. A smooth, stable carriage is essential for consistent slicing.
* **The Thickness Control:** This allows you to adjust the thickness of the slices, from paper-thin to thick-cut.
* **Safety Features:** Safety is paramount. Look for features like blade guards, non-slip feet, and on/off switches with safety locks.

An advanced principle to consider is the angle of the blade. Some slicers have angled blades, which can improve slicing performance and reduce waste. The sharpness of the blade is also critical; a dull blade can tear or crush food instead of slicing it cleanly.

## Insightful Q&A Section

Here are 10 insightful questions and expert answers related to electric food slicers for home use:

1. **Q: What is the ideal blade size for a home electric food slicer, and why?**

**A:** For most home users, a 9-inch to 10-inch blade is ideal. This size provides a good balance between slicing capacity and storage space. Larger blades are typically found on commercial slicers and may be overkill for home use.

2. **Q: How often should I sharpen the blade on my electric food slicer?**

**A:** The frequency of sharpening depends on how often you use the slicer and the types of foods you slice. As a general rule, sharpen the blade every 2-3 months with regular use. If you notice the blade is struggling to slice cleanly, it’s time to sharpen it.

3. **Q: What types of foods can I safely slice with an electric food slicer?**

**A:** Electric food slicers can be used to slice a wide variety of foods, including deli meats, cheeses, vegetables, fruits, and bread. Avoid slicing bones or extremely hard items, as this can damage the blade.

4. **Q: How do I properly clean and maintain my electric food slicer?**

**A:** Always unplug the slicer before cleaning. Remove the food carriage and blade (if possible) and wash them with warm, soapy water. Wipe down the motor housing with a damp cloth. Lubricate the moving parts with food-grade oil as needed. Store the slicer in a clean, dry place.

5. **Q: What safety features should I look for when buying an electric food slicer?**

**A:** Look for features like a blade guard, an on/off switch with a safety lock, and non-slip feet. These features will help prevent accidents and ensure safe operation.

6. **Q: Can I use an electric food slicer to slice frozen meat?**

**A:** Yes, some electric food slicers are designed to slice frozen meat. However, it’s important to use a slicer with a powerful motor and a sharp blade. Partially thaw the meat before slicing to make it easier to cut.

7. **Q: What is the difference between a smooth blade and a serrated blade on an electric food slicer?**

**A:** Smooth blades are best for slicing delicate foods like deli meats and cheeses. Serrated blades are better for slicing bread and tougher foods like vegetables.

8. **Q: How do I adjust the thickness of the slices on my electric food slicer?**

**A:** Most electric food slicers have an adjustable thickness control, which is typically a dial or knob. Turn the dial to adjust the thickness of the slices. Start with a thin setting and gradually increase the thickness until you achieve the desired result.

9. **Q: What is the best way to store my electric food slicer?**

**A:** Store the slicer in a clean, dry place, away from moisture and extreme temperatures. Cover the blade with a blade guard to protect it from damage. Store the slicer in its original box or a storage bag to keep it clean and dust-free.
